Transforming the Digital Card Game Landscape
The resurgence of digital card games is underpinned by several industry drivers, including increased smartphone penetration, the rise of blockchain integrations, and the evolution of cloud gaming. Notably:
- Accessibility: Cloud-based platforms and web-first approaches lower entry barriers, allowing players to access complex games directly via browsers without requiring downloads or heavy hardware.
- Interactivity & Community: Modern DCGs foster vibrant online communities, Tournaments, and real-time interactions that mirror social networks.
- Technological Innovation: Incorporating AI-based opponents, AR/VR components, and dynamic visual effects elevates gameplay immersion.
